Miniposter PRO
Модуль для потокового создания уменьшенных изображений.
Этот модуль является продолжением бесплатной версии модуля - Создание минипостеров.
После выпуска бесплатной версии было много вопросов по использованию, и вообще глобального недопонимания, зачем оно нужно.
Объясню на примере двух своих сайтов, где вы сможете сами в живую все проверить.
В первую очередь тут, на SanDev.pro, в шаблоне комментария аватарка выводится в кружочке.
Этот эффект достигнут при помощи наложения на исходное изображение такой маски:
Скрипт уменьшает исходное изображение, обрезает лишнее и накладывает маску.
Как это выглядит в шаблоне:
<img src="/posters/ava/{foto}" class="comment-ava" alt="{login}" />
Теперь рассмотрим на примере второго сайта, Ludos.ru. Как видно, на главной и в категориях все изображения имеют одинаковый размер и имеют gloss эффект. Подобное достигнуто опять же при помощи изображения наложения:
В шаблоне это выглядит так:
<img src="/posters/main/{image-1}" alt="{title}" title="{title}" />
Т.е. как видно из примеров, скрипт сам в потоковом режиме обрабатывает все указанные в шаблоне изображения.
Так же для примера приведу вот такое изображение:
И допустим мне надо его уменьшить и обрезать до размеров Ширина = 150px, Высота = 250px.
Для этого достаточно подправить путь:
/uploads/posts/2013-09/1378891382_pano.jpg
Дописываем в адрес:
/posters/150_250_90_1/uploads/posts/2013-09/1378891382_pano.jpg
В чем же разница с бесплатной версией, она огромна.
1. В бесплатной версии все (!) обрабатываемые изображения выводятся через файл miniposter.php Т.е. чем больше картинок выводится через модуль, тем большая нагрузка создается на файл. Кеш в данном случае не сильно помогает.
2. Добавилась возможность обрезания по маске, png24 изображение.
3. Добавилась поддержка внешних УРЛ (пример). Т.е. скрипт может создавать постеры из изображений расположенных на стороннем сервере.
Выделю плюсы и особенности платной версии.
Т.к. в адресе не фигурирует .php расширения, поисковики нормально индексируют данные изображения именно как изображения (простите за тавтологию).
Файл изображения физически находится по указанному адресу. Т.е. если в той версии всегда идет обращение к php файлу, а тот уже проверял - есть кеш или нету. То в этой версии php задействуется только единожды и только в том случае, если файла на сервере нету. Исключением являются только внешние ссылки, для них php запускается каждый раз, чтобы либо создать постер либо отдать из кеша.
Условия продажи:
Персональный аттестат Webmoney или BL>40
Стоимость данного модуля составляет 7wmz
Для связи со мной:
ICQ: 404-037-556
E-Mail: olalod@mail.ru
Skype: Sander8804 (просьба не присылать запросы на авторизацию, а сразу писать по делу)
С уважением,
Олег Александрович a.k.a. Sander